How have humans impacted the evolution of other species?
Are humans inadvertently driving evolution in other species? Mounting evidence suggests activities such as commercial fishing, angling and hunting, along with the use of pesticides and antibiotics, are leading to dramatic evolutionary changes.
What is androgyny in psychology?
In psychology, androgyny refers to individuals with strong personality traits associated with both sexes, combining toughness and gentleness, assertiveness and nurturing behaviour, as called for by the situation.

What is the history of androgyny?
History of Androgyny. The term androgyny has been in existence for some time, although its meaning has changed since it first came into use. The word stems from the Greek word androgynos, which refers to hermaphroditism—having both male and female reproductive organs.
Is an androgynous appearance acceptable today?
An androgynous appearance is more widely accepted today than it has been in the past, but due to often harmful societal expectations of gender, many individuals who have an androgynous appearance may still experience stigma and discrimination.
What is the importance of androgyny in psychology?
Psychological androgyny, which is often represented through physical androgyny, has been associated positively with self-esteem, life satisfaction, relationship satisfaction, competence, behavioral and cognitive flexibility, and an overall sense of well-being, as well as creativity.
